The zombie at the far end of the hall, right before you step up onto the ledge, is the first zombie worth killing. One of them may do that ‘double lunge’ thing they sometimes do as you pass, but if you keep running forward they won’t get you don’t be alarmed if they do, it most likely means you bumped into something along the way and lost a second of your head start. There are three zombies in your immediate path, but you can outmaneuver them if you keep moving. Keep to the right, hugging the garbage (but not so tight that you’re actively running against the trash, slowing you down). Charge straight ahead and don’t stop moving, even as zombies rise.

While there is a door to your left, it is sealed, so don’t bother. Just after your slide down from your spawn point (and the “My extraction!” conversation), HUNK will be dropped into this hallway, with heaps of garbage on either side of him. With Resident Evil 2 Remake, that challenge has grown tenfold with its new and improved 4th Survivor Mode. Stepping into the boots of USS Soldier HUNK, we are tasked with escaping to the RPD’s front gate while wading through a sea of the undead and worse. For generations, The 4th Survivor has been one of the greatest challenges in the entire series, focusing not on combat, but on the dexterity of your reflexes and planning.
